Borgo San Biagio
A unique and intriguing holiday venue, this is a rare opportunity to enjoy the exclusive use of an entire historic hamlet. The remarkable ‘borgo’ (or little village), considered one of the most beautiful in Italy, basks amid verdant hills, within easy reach of medieval towns in both Umbria and Tuscany. Sympathetically restored by its owner Renato, it comprises six separate buildings, clustered in tree-shaded grounds with many different spots with ample outdoor furniture in sun and shade for reading or play. In various sizes for two to five guests, each is individually styled to retain its character while adding modern comforts, and all have a private furnished garden terrace. The accommodation layout is straightforward. The 'hamlet houses' of Casa del Contadino, Il Forno, Casa del Prete are all set in a horseshoe shape. Casa del Castagno with panoramic furnished terrace is set slightly apart. Casa di Venere and The Tower are at the other end of the hamlet. The thousand year old Tower villa boasts a rooftop terrace, with spectacular views unchanged by the centuries, and a rather contemporary hot tub from which to enjoy them.
Cook service can be pre-booked, barbecue and delightful informal pizza evenings can be arranged, and the borgo’s Club is a rustic, informal but elegant dining room with fully equipped kitchen and bar area with an al fresco table on the terrace big enough for everyone. The old chapel, now a convivial sitting room, is also used for wedding blessings. And the focal point of the country gardens is an eighteen metre heated swimming pool.
Renato, the owner who lives a few kilometres away, remains unobtrusive, but is always on hand to ensure his guests are happy and contented. Nothing is too much for him. He will arrange a wedding breakfast for honeymooners, a barbecue and pizza evenings for a private group, horse riding in the surrounding hills, a trip to the local spa, or even a truffle hunting expedition in the surrounding area in Autumn!
